Job title – Supply Chain Specialist (Animal Nutrition)
Location – Across APAC Countries
We are looking for a passionate and enthusiastic person to join the EssCo Regional team.
The Supply Chain Coordinator will oversee the inventory of in-house manufactured materials, guaranteeing optimal inventory levels and taking proactive measures to identify and address potential supply risks within the regional distribution center and EssCo customers in the region. This pivotal role involves strategic engagement with the GSM team but also clear alignment with the regional sales organization to fulfill regional requirements, streamlining internal processes to enhance customer satisfaction and achieving the regional supply chain objectives.
Your Key Responsibilities:
Supply Planning & Inventory Management
- Collaborate with E2E Supply Manager to ensure appropriate inventory levels in the region, swiftly identifying anomalies and determining root causes. Coordinate phase-in/out strategies and material substitutions in partnership with Nutritional Services and Commercial.
- Work with Global Supply & Inventory Planners and Global Supply Chain Managers to ensure timely replenishment shipments to the Regional Distribution Center. Monitor and promptly communicate any shipment delays or issues to the EssCo E2E Supply Manager and Commercial team.
- Support the Commercial Team and Customer Care in resolving order fulfillment issues, including inventory allocation and special batch requirements.
- Provide support to the E2E Supply Manager in effectively managing working capital and achieving regional inventory targets.
Transport Coordination & Execution
- Support the coordination of the transportation flows by the 3PL from port to regional distribution center and from warehouse to customers, ensuring service, cost, and lead-time targets are met.
- Support the global team to set up a global 4PL project implementation
- Ensure good collaboration with the logistic service provider to resolve operational issues (delays, documentation, customs constraints) in close collaboration with internal stakeholders and logistics partners.
- Support optimization of transport flows, consolidation opportunities, and freight cost efficiency in alignment with regional logistics strategy.
3PL & Warehouse Coordination
- Act as the primary point of contact for the regional 3PL warehouse provider, ensuring alignment on inbound, storage, and outbound operations.
- Support day-to-day coordination and oversight of the regional warehouse performed by the logistic service provider, ensuring adherence to agreed service levels (OTIF, lead times, inventory accuracy).
- Monitor warehouse performance (e.g., stock accuracy, handling times, dispatch reliability) and escalate deviations or risks.
- Coordinate with 3PL on inventory issues (damages, blocked stock, discrepancies) and drive timely resolution in collaboration with Quality and Supply teams.
- Support continuous improvement of warehouse and logistics processes, contributing to efficiency, service reliability, and cost optimization.
Cross-functional Alignment
- Ensure strong coordination between Planning, Logistics, Commercial, Customer Care, and external partners (3PL, carriers).
- Provide visibility on supply and logistics risks, enabling proactive decision-making and prioritization.

You Bring:
- Bachelor’s degree or Equivalent Experience in Production, Planning, or Inventory Analysis
- 3–5+ years of experience in supply coordination, logistics, and/or inventory management
- Experience working in regional or international B2B supply chains, preferably within APAC
- Proficiency of SAP Materials Management and Sales and Distribution functions.
- Demonstrated statistical, analytical, and problem-solving skills using various software and tools.
- Proficiency and experience with a variety of Supply Chain Management concepts and procedures e.g. MRP, Inventory Coverage, Operating Working Capital, Demand Planning, OTIF (On Time In Full).
- Experience working within or closely alongside logistics operations.
- Solid quantitative computer skills including MS suite.
- Strong experience in SAP (APO/R3), BW and the master data driving the various systems and processes.
